Using gcc version 4.2.0 20051217 (experimental) to compile the attached
testcase like this
-------------------------------
gcc -O2 -fgcse-sm -c -o mjpeg.o mjpeg.c
-------------------------------
I get the following:
-------------------------------
mjpeg.c: In function ?mjpeg_picture_trailer?:
mjpeg.c:566: error: unrecognizable insn:
(insn:HI 452 282 286 27 (set (reg:SI 186 [ bit_buf ])
(ashift:SI (mem/s:SI (plus:SI (reg/v/f:SI 109 [ s ])
(const_int 84 [0x54])) [4 <variable>.pb.bit_buf+0 S4 A32])
(subreg:QI (reg/v:SI 90 [ bit_left ]) 0))) -1 (nil)
(expr_list:REG_DEAD (reg/v:SI 90 [ bit_left ])
(nil)))
mjpeg.c:566: internal compiler error: in extract_insn, at recog.c:2084
Please submit a full bug report,
with preprocessed source if appropriate.
See <URL:http://gcc.gnu.org/bugs.html> for instructions.
-------------------------------
on both x86 and x86_64 architectures.
